  Abstract      = "We produce exact cubic analogues of Jacobi's celebrated theta function identity and of the arithmetic-geometric mean iteration of Gauss and Legendre. The iteration in question is $$a\_{n+1}: = \frac{a\_n + 2b\_n}{3} \text \,{and} b\_{n+1}: = \root 3 \of {b\_n \Bigg(\frac{a^2\_n + a\_nb\_n + b^2\_n}{3}\Bigg)}$$. The limit of this iteration is identified in terms of the hypergeometric function $\_2 F\_1(1/3, 2/3; 1; \cdot)$, which supports a particularly simple cubic transformation.",
